Where is Java Used in Industry?
Java, a universal and important programming language, has been a base in the tech field for decades. Known for its platform independence, scalability, and robustness, Java continues to dominate varied domains. But where exactly is Java used in the industry? Let’s dive deep into the different operations of Java in the moment's technological geography.
Web Development
Java is widely used for developing dynamic web applications. Fabrics like Spring, Hibernate, and Struts enable inventors to make scalable and secure web applications efficiently. For instance
Enterprise Applications Companies like LinkedIn and Amazon depend on Java for their backend systems.
E-Commerce Platforms Java powers numerous online shopping portals, ensuring flawless user experiences and transaction security.
Mobile Development
When it comes to mobile app development, Java plays a crucial role, especially for Android applications. Android SDK (Software Development Kit) is primarily based on Java, making it the go-to language for designers creating apps for millions of Android devices worldwide.
Enterprise Software
Java’s capability to handle large-scale systems makes it a favorite choice for enterprise software development. Its features like multithreading, memory management, and robust security make it ideal for
- Customer Relationship Management (CRM)
- Enterprise Resource Planning (ERP)
- Financial Systems
For example, numerous banking systems use Java to process millions of deals daily while maintaining high security and performance standards.
Big Data and Analytics
The rise of big data has seen Java arise as a crucial player in this domain. Tools like Hadoop and Apache Spark are built using Java, enabling businesses to process and analyze massive datasets efficiently. Java’s scalability and performance are critical for big data results that demand high trustability.
Cloud Computing
In the time of cloud computing, Java’s platform independence is a significant advantage. It's extensively used to develop cloud- based applications and services, with major cloud providers like Amazon Web Services( AWS) and Google Cloud Platform( GCP) offering SDKs that support Java.
Internet of Things (IoT)
The Internet of Things connected devices, detectors, and software to change data seamlessly. Java’s lightweight and platform-independent nature makes it an excellent choice for IoT applications. It's used to develop
- Embedded Systems
- Smart Home bias
- Industrial IoT Applications
Java’s ability to work on small devices and its robust ecosystem make it indispensable in the IoT geography.
Scientific Applications
Java is also prominent in scientific computing and exploration. Its perfection, trustability, and availability of fine libraries make it a suitable choice for
- Simulations and Modeling
- Data Visualization Tools
- Mathematical and Statistical Analysis
Game Development
Although not as popular as C or Unity for high-end game development, Java is still used in creating mobile games and indie projects. Libraries like LibGDX and frameworks like jMonkeyEngine give the tools demanded for building engaging games.
Banking and Finance
Security and trustability are critical in the financial sector, making Java a natural choice. It powers backend systems for banks, payment gateways, and trading platforms. Java’s features, like high-performance computing and cryptographic security, make it indispensable for
- Online Banking Systems
- Stock Market Platforms
- Financial Data Analysis Tools
Artificial Intelligence and Machine Learning
Java is gaining traction in AI and machine education, thanks to libraries like Weka, Deeplearning4j, and MOA. Its capability to process large datasets and integrate with big data tools makes it suitable for AI applications in areas like
- Natural Language Processing (NLP)
- Recommendation Systems
- Predictive Analytics
Healthcare
In the healthcare sector, Java is used to make applications for managing patient records, scheduling, and diagnostics. Its robust security and ability to handle large-scale data make it ideal for
- Electronic Health Records (EHR)
- Medical Imaging Systems
- Healthcare Analytics Platforms
Why Java Remains Applicable
Java’s enduring relevance can be attributed to several factors.
- Platform Independence: Write once, run anywhere (WORA) enables Java applications to run on any device with a Java Virtual Machine (JVM).
- Community Support: A vast and active developer community ensures continuous updates and troubleshooting.
- Rich Ecosystem: Java boasts an extensive library and framework ecosystem, catering to different industry requirements.
